The created BIM model, which is created from a cloud of points obtained as a result of scanning and processing using specialized software, allows for construction analysis, reconstruction design and operational management of the object and its parameters.
The use of 3D laser scanning technology to measure buildings makes it possible to obtain a point cloud and subsequently generate digital documentation that will allow the creation of a BIM model of the scanned object.
When renovating a historic building or site that requires a critical understanding of the existing construction site, point clouds can be used to obtain a 3D model of the existing structure. Point cloud data can be used to create new building information models or update existing models with new data. Using the correct point density and resolution, point cloud models can accurately represent the characteristics of virtually any object or 3D space.
Instead of using traditional rudimentary shapes or manually collecting data, Point Cloud technology can create a three-dimensional representation of any object or space using ‘dots’ placed on laser-visible surfaces.
It provides project architects, engineers and construction teams with an accurate way to scan, create and modify 3D models or ‘digital twins’ of incredibly detailed and interactive physical locations.
Scanning a finished design and converting the resulting point cloud data into a 3D model with associated metadata is a process sometimes called scan to BIM modeling. Depending on the method used to capture the point cloud and the sensors involved, each point may also include RGB color data or even intensify information that reflects the reciprocal strength of the laser pulse that generated the point.
